Footpath 61, Myland (Temporary Prohibition of Use) Order 2024

Notice is hereby given that further to a Notice on the 1st October 2024 the Essex County Council has made the above Order under section 14(1) of the Road Traffic Regulation Act 1984 (as amended).

Effect of the order: Further to a Notice on the 1st October 2024 Essex County Council has temporarily closed Footpath 61, Myland, in the City of Colchester from a point approximately 30 metres east of its junction with the A134 Northern Approach, eastwards for approximately 74 metres.

The closure is required for the safety of the public and workforce whilst works are carried out for the ongoing construction of an adjacent compound.

The alternative route is Footpath 61, around the compound to a point where it joins the existing section of Footpath 61, and vice versa.

The closure came into effect on 6th October 2024 and may continue in force for six months, or until the works have been completed, whichever is the earlier. This Order may be extended by the Secretary of State if an extension is required.
